Yes Bega peanut butter is safe for dogs. According to the Bega website their peanut butter “contains no added sugar salt artificial colours or flavours making it a healthier option compared to other brands.” Brands like Jif and Smuckers add sugar salt and other artificial ingredients to their peanut butter which can be harmful to dogs.

Bega’s peanut butter is also100% Australian made and they source their peanuts from Australian farmers.

The Bega website also has a section dedicated to pet recipes and one of the recipes is for “Puppy Love Peanut Butter Cookies.” The ingredients for the cookies are: 1 cup Bega Smooth Peanut Butter 1 egg 1/4 cup whole wheat flour and 1/4 cup rolled oats.

So if you’re looking for a safe and healthy peanut butter for your dog Bega is a great option!

How much Bega peanut butter can I give my dog?

Answer: The amount of Bega peanut butter you can give your dog will depend on their size and weight.

For example a small dog can have 1-2 teaspoons of peanut butter while a large dog can have 1-2 tablespoons.

How do I know if my dog is allergic to Bega peanut butter?

Answer: The best way to know if your dog is allergic to Bega peanut butter is to give them a small amount and see if they have any reactions.

Symptoms of an allergy can include vomiting diarrhea and difficulty breathing.

If you think your dog is allergic you should take them to the vet for further evaluation.
